Living with Art – Painting on Wood

This week we painted on wood and I wanted to do something that would be fun for the kids to paint.  I bought these fish from St Lawrence River Decoys.  The fish are sanded and ready to paint.  They also come with the glass eyes. My husband drilled a hole in the bottom of the fish and added the dowel and base.

At the beginning of class we talked about different ways we could paint them and some details that we could add around the eyes.  Since the kids had a few classes they were really thinking about different ways that they could paint them.  I think they did a great job, what do you think?

My other class is a family and they decided to use red, white and blue so that their fish would coordinate and they could be out all summer from Memorial Day to 4th of July to Labor Day.

!Hamfam

Daniel wanted to have teeth on his fish, so we used Quikwood and Super Glue to add them.

It was a really fun project.  We used DecoArt Americana acrylic paints on the projects.
